The Evolution of Puffer Jacket Materials

Puffer jackets have a rich history of material innovation. From mountain climbers to city streets, their design has come a long way. Initially, puffer jackets relied solely on natural down insulation. This material, from ducks or geese, gave excellent warmth but fell short when wet. As wearers ventured into diverse climates, change was necessary.

Early puffer materials often struggled with moisture. Wet down loses insulating power, leaving adventurers cold. To solve this, synthetic fibers were introduced. These man-made materials, such as polyester, mimic down’s warmth yet resist moisture better. Today, modern puffers blend fashion with functionality, often using advanced synthetics.

Material technology in puffer jackets continues to advance. Now we have options like recycled fibers, boosting sustainability. We also see treatments like Durable Water Repellant (DWR) for better water resistance. Choices like hybrid insulation – combining down and synthetic – offer the best of both worlds.

With each material iteration, puffer jackets get lighter, warmer, and more resilient. This evolution mirrors the changing needs of wearers, from extreme sports to everyday comfort. Synthetic vs. Natural Insulation Explained

Understanding the difference between synthetic and natural insulation is key. Both types have distinct features and benefits that suit different needs.

Synthetic Materials Overview

Synthetic insulation includes materials like polyester. It’s man-made and designed to mimic down’s warmth. It performs well even when wet, making it ideal for damp conditions. Synthetics tend to be more affordable than natural options. They’re also less prone to losing warmth when wet. Their durability is another plus, with many retaining insulation power after washes.

Natural Materials and Their Benefits

Natural insulation comes from ducks or geese, known as down. Down is praised for its light weight and excellent warmth. It has a high warmth-to-weight ratio, meaning a little goes a long way. However, down’s weakness is moisture. When wet, it loses insulating properties. To address this, some down is treated to resist water. This treatment enhances its performance in wet environments. Natural materials often come with a higher cost, reflecting their quality.

The Importance of Outer Shell in Puffer Jackets

The outer shell of puffer jackets is crucial. It shields against wind and water. Jackets often use nylon or polyester for this. These fabrics are strong and help keep you dry. They sometimes get a special coating. This makes them repel water even better. When choosing a jacket, consider the shell’s materials. A good shell means lasting warmth and dryness. It’s the jacket’s first defense in cold weather.

Making the Right Choice: Selecting a Puffer Jacket

Choosing the right puffer jacket involves several factors. Start with the climate you live in. Cold, dry areas may suit down insulation, while wetter zones are better for synthetic fill. Think about your activities too. For outdoor sports, seek a light, flexible jacket. Daily city life might call for a stylish, durable option.

Consider the jacket’s fill power if you opt for down. A higher fill power offers more warmth per ounce. For synthetic, check the density. Dense insulation means more warmth without too much bulk.

Look at the outer shell material as well. Nylon and polyester are common and resist the wind and light rain. A jacket with a water-repellent coating adds extra protection.

Pay attention to the design. Features like strong zippers, secure seams, and functional pockets add value. They can keep you warmer and more comfortable.

Finally, don’t forget about fit. A jacket that’s too tight restricts movement. One that’s too loose won’t trap heat well. Try different styles to find one that fits right and feels good.
